Leading Causes of Truck Accidents in Pettis County, MO
Truck accidents in Pettis County, MO are often the result of preventable factors rather than unavoidable events. In many cases, negligence, whether by a driver, trucking company, or another party, plays a significant role. Identifying the underlying cause of a crash is essential to building a strong legal claim.
Some of the most common causes of truck accidents in Pettis County and throughout Missouri include:
- Driver fatigue: Long hours on the road and violations of federal hours-of-service regulations can lead to dangerously tired drivers
- Distracted driving: Phones, GPS systems, and other distractions take focus off the road
- Speeding: Due to their size and weight, trucks require more time and distance to stop safely
- Improper cargo loading: Unbalanced or unsecured loads can shift during transit, leading to rollovers or loss of control
- Mechanical failures: Brake issues, tire blowouts, and other equipment failures often result from poor maintenance
- Hazardous road conditions: Weather and construction zones can increase the risk of serious collisions
Major trucking routes see heavy commercial traffic in the Pettis County, MO area, increasing the likelihood of serious collisions. Identifying the exact cause of the accident is a key part of determining liability and pursuing compensation.

Determining Liability in a Truck Accident in Pettis County, MO
When it comes to truck accidents in Pettis County, MO, responsibility isn’t always straightforward. Unlike a typical car crash, multiple people or companies may share fault, which makes these cases more complicated—but also more important to investigate fully.
Depending on the details of your truck accident in Pettis County, MO, liability may involve one or more of the following:
- The truck driver — for negligent behavior such as speeding, driver fatigue, or inattention
- The trucking company — if they failed to properly train the driver or pushed unsafe schedules
- Cargo loading companies — if improperly loaded or unsecured cargo contributed to the crash
- Maintenance crews — for failing to properly inspect or repair the vehicle
- Vehicle or parts manufacturers — if defective parts or equipment played a role in the crash
In many Pettis County, MO-area cases, these parties will attempt to shift blame to avoid liability. That’s why a thorough investigation is critical. What Compensation Can You Recover After a Truck Accident in Pettis County, MO?
After a truck accident in Pettis County, MO, one of the biggest concerns is how much compensation you may be able to recover. The answer depends on your injuries, how your life has been affected, and the circumstances surrounding the crash.
Truck accident victims in Pettis County, MO may be entitled to compensation for both economic and non-economic damages, including:
Economic Damages:
- Medical bills, hospital stays, and future treatment
- Lost income and diminished earning capacity
- Vehicle damage and replacement costs
- Rehabilitation, therapy, and continued care
- Out-of-pocket expenses related to your recovery in the Pettis County, MO area
Personal Impacts:
- Pain and suffering
- Emotional stress and trauma
- Loss of enjoyment of life
- Long-term or permanent injuries
- Wrongful death damages (for surviving family members)

Steps to Take After a Truck Accident in Pettis County, MO
The steps you take after a truck accident in Pettis County, MO can directly impact your health, your recovery, and your ability to pursue compensation. Truck accidents in Pettis County, MO are often far more complex than standard car crashes, so taking the right actions early can make a significant difference in your case.
Step 1: Get Medical Care Right Away in Pettis County, MO
Even if you feel okay, don’t assume you’re uninjured. Many truck accident injuries—like internal bleeding, concussions, or soft tissue damage—don’t show symptoms right away.
Getting medical attention early in Pettis County, MO helps catch hidden injuries and creates a record that connects your condition to the accident, which is important for any claim you may file.
Step 2: Report the Accident to Law Enforcement
Contacting law enforcement after a truck accident in Pettis County, MO is essential. Officers will document the scene, collect statements, and prepare an official report that may be used as evidence in your case.
When speaking with police, focus on providing accurate, factual information. Avoid guessing or making statements about fault, as these can later be used during the claims process.
Step 3: Gather Evidence at the Scene
If you can, use your phone to document everything at the scene. Take pictures or videos of the vehicles, damage, road conditions, and anything else that might help explain what happened.
Be sure to obtain contact information from the truck driver, witnesses, and any other involved parties. Truck accident cases in Pettis County, MO often depend heavily on early evidence, and what you gather in those first moments can be critical later.
Step 4: Approach Insurance Companies with Caution
After a truck accident in Pettis County, MO, insurance companies may reach out right away. It’s important to be cautious—because their goal is usually to limit what they have to pay.
Before providing statements, signing paperwork, or accepting any offers, make sure you understand your rights. Even minor comments can be used to challenge or reduce your claim.
